The AI POS Gold Rush for Credit Card Resellers
How to beat Square & Toast by winning the trillion‑dollar “ignored” Main Street market.

The problem you’re living

Square and Toast win when the conversation is just about a card reader and a slick POS. But in the neighborhoods where merchants run on tight margins, tiny tickets, EBT/SNAP, tobacco scan data, and dual pricing, those platforms either don’t fit, or they’re too pricey and rigid. That’s your opening.

Partnering with an AI POS built for corner‑store retail flips the script. You keep the processing, add a sticky POS your merchants actually love, and suddenly you can unlock ~$1 trillion in independent retail that’s been historically underserved (convenience, liquor, small grocery, 99¢, ethnic foods, tobacco, pet, beauty, delis, and more).

Why this changes your sales math

  • You keep the merchant and the residuals. The platform is 100% indirect and doesn’t compete with partners for processing, so your relationship stays yours

  • It opens the doors Square/Toast can’t. The product is designed for low‑tech, low‑ticket, low‑margin stores in dense urban areas (often immigrant‑owned), many using EBT/SNAP and dual pricing

  • It’s a churn killer. Once your merchant runs pricing, taxes, inventory hints, and daily ops through the POS, switching becomes painful—for them, not you .

What you can sell—without getting technical

Easiest POS for busy shops. “Works like a cash register but is 1000x more powerful.” Scan, ring, pay—done (page 10). Preloaded with 200k+ items and a UPC database means almost no manual SKU typing 

Dual Pricing that’s actually compliant. Built‑in cash/card receipts and a free customer price‑checker QR app help merchants stay right in NY/CA and everywhere else 

Multilingual out of the box. 12 languages (Spanish, Arabic, Mandarin, Bengali, Urdu, Korean, Gujarati, Punjabi, Hindi, and more) so owners and staff can work in what’s comfortable 

Tobacco scan‑data & age checks. Altria/RJRT programs, multipack/loyalty, and ID scanning—huge in c‑store and smoke‑shop verticals

Processor‑friendly and device‑friendly. Works with PAX and Valor terminals, so you can place it with your existing processor relationships

Sell the outcome, not the tech. Smarter pricing, product mix tips, and tax guidance help stores earn more with fewer headaches 


The simple economics (the part agents love)

  • Tiny upfront, real stickiness. Bodega Ai POS is affordable for all and most qualifying merchants can get the hardware bundle free

  • Your lane, your terminal. You or your ISO provide the PAX A35 or Valor VL/VP; the POS plays nice, and you keep the account

  • Volume is there. The average corner store runs about $40k/month in card volume—with dual pricing, shoppers cover fees and you protect margins


Who to target first (your fast‑win list)

  • Independent convenience & small grocery

  • Liquor and tobacco/smoke shops (need scan‑data + age checks)

  • 99¢/discount, ethnic food, delis, pet & beauty supply
    These are exactly the segments highlighted in the deck’s $1T TAM and “Urban Underserved Niches” slides—where dual pricing and EBT matter and where big brands are least flexible
